HOUSE BILL 383

AN ACT relative to operation of OHRVs on the traveled portion of public highways, where permitted.

SPONSORS: Rep. Theberge, Coos 3

COMMITTEE: Transportation

ANALYSIS

This bill requires that operators of OHRVs on the traveled portion of public highways, where permitted, shall be licensed to drive or accompanied by a person who is licensed to drive.

STATE OF NEW HAMPSHIRE

In the Year of Our Lord Two Thousand Thirteen

AN ACT relative to operation of OHRVs on the traveled portion of public highways, where permitted.

Be it En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ives in General Court convened:

1 New Paragraph; OHRV Operation on Traveled Portion of Public Highway. Amend RSA 215-A:29 by inserting after paragraph I the following new paragraph:

I-a. Notwithstanding provisions of this chapter to the contrary:

(a) Any unaccompanied person operating an OHRV on the traveled portion of a public highway, where permitted, shall be required to be licensed to drive as described in subparagraph I(b)(2); and

(b) Any person operating an OHRV on the traveled portion of a public highway, where permitted, who is not licensed to drive as described in subparagraph I(b)(2) shall be accompanied at all times by a person who is licensed to drive as described in subparagraph I(b)(2) and who shall be legally responsible and be liable according to law for personal injury or property damage to others which may result from such operation by an unlicensed person.

2 Effective Date. This act shall take effect January 1, 2014.
